• Das Erstellen neuer Accounts wurde ausgesetzt. Bei berechtigtem Interesse bitte Kontaktaufnahme über die üblichen Wege. Beste Grüße der Admin

in Datenbank schreiben - ASP-Gott gesucht

hupfer

New member
hallo zusammen

also, ich bin am asp lernen... nun habe ich eine access datenbank usw... habe sie schon verknüpft usw... auslesen habe ich schon geschafft.... so, nun möchte ich was rein schreiben, leider funktioniert das eifach net :-(

ich habe folgenden code:
Code:
 <%@ Language=VBScript %>
<h1>Add News</h1>
<%
vname="raffi"
vnews="fäbu"
datum = "20011001"
'vname=Request.Form("name")
'vnews=Request.Form("news")
'datum = date()
SET con = Server.CreateObject("ADODB.Connection")
con.Open "DSN=news"
con.execute "INSERT INTO tbl_news (Name,Datum,News) VALUES (" & vname & " , " & datum & " , " & vnews & ")"
%>

vielleicht kann mir ja jemand helfen ? :)

besten dank schon im vorraus
mfg
fabian
 
ich kenn mich zwar mit ASP ned aus, aber
1. welche Fehlermeldung spuckt er denn aus?
2. würd ich die Values für Name, News und Datum quoten (z.b. mit ' ), da es sich hier um Text-, bzw. Datumsfelder handelt und SQL des irgendwie interpretieren muß....

hoffe des hilft ....

Albu
 
Code:
"INSERT INTO tbl_news (Name,Datum,News) VALUES ('" & vname & "' , GetDate() , '" & vnews & "')"

Beachte hierbei die ' vor und nach den Values. Ausserdem kannst du das Datum per GetDate() bekommen, der nimmt dann automatisch aktuelle Uhrzeit und aktuelles Datum, wenn deine Felder Datefelder sind.

Bei ASP fragen ruhig an mich wenden, ich mach den ganzen Tag nix anderes als SQL, ASP, VB und DCOM bei meiner Ausbildung =)
 
hi zusammen

hi zusammen

also, ich habe es geschafft....danke euch trotzdem..... es lag an den schreibrechten von meiner access datenbank :)

danke trotzdem

grüsse
fabian
 
Zurück
Oben